AS A SENIOR (2018-19): Horizon League Champion, 200 Free...successfully defended her conference championship in the 200 free...also broke her own school record in the 100 free...was undefeated in the 200 free in dual meets...her only non-first place finish in the event was a fifth place swim at the TYR Invitational...took first place in five of her six dual meets in the 100 free, and was second in the sixth...was third in the conference in the 100 free...swam the 500 free for the first time in her career, and had two top-two finishes during the regular season...placed second in the 500 at conference...won the 1650 free in her lone start in the event, against Cleveland State and IUPUI...likewise won the 200 back and 100 IM in her only career swims in each...swam the 200 IM three times and won it every time...named UIC's Most Valuable Swimmer.

AS A JUNIOR (2017-18):  Horizon League Champion, 200 Free...set school records in the 100 free, 200 free, and 200 IM, with her 200 free time also breaking the Horizon League record...won the 100 (:52.01) and 200 (1:52.90) free against Indiana State, led off the winning 200 free relay team, and anchored the victorious 400 medley relay team...won the 100 and 200 again versus Green Bay and Valparaiso, with improved times in each race...her 200 medley and 400 free relay teams each took first place...was second across the board in the 100 and 200 free and 200 IM against Northwestern, Rutgers, and Chicago, marking the only time all season she did not win the 200 free in a dual/tri/quad meet...moved to the anchor leg of the free relay, which won the 400...swept the 100, 200, and 200 IM against Milwaukee, setting then-season best times in each...remained in the anchor leg of the first place 400 free relay team...won the 200 free and 200 IM against Oakland, and took second in the 100 free, making it one of two regular season meets in which she did not win the 100...finished second as part of the 400 free relay team...was sixth in the 100 free (:51.09), third in the 200 free (1:49.35), and third in the 200 IM (2:02.77) at the TYR Invitational...led off the 200 and 400 free relays, and swam second in the 800, helping the Flames to a top-8 finish in each...went 5-for-5 in the two day meet at Cleveland State with IUPUI, winning the 100 and 200 free twice each and the 50 free once...added two wins and two second place finishes in relay action...won the 200 free in a conference record time of 1:47.24 at the Horizon League Championships...that time qualified for the NCAA B-cut...took third in the 100 free (:50.42) and fourth in the 200 IM (2:02.19)...had a second place finish, two thirds, and a fifth in relay competition.

AS A SOPHOMORE (2016-17): Captured a trio of victories against Cleveland State in the 200 free (1:53.14), the 100 free (51:72) and the 200 free relay (1:37.29) while finishing second in the 400 medley relay (3:55.14) on Jan. 14…won the 200 IM (2:06.03), the 400 medley relay (3:51.75), the 200 free (1:51.98), the 100 free (51.84) and the 800 free relay (7:45.93), while earning a trio of second place finishes in the 200 free relay (1:36.69), the 200 medley relay (1:46.21) and the 400 free relay (3:33.31) versus Olivet-Nazarene and Milwaukee at the Flames Invitational (Jan. 20-21)…notched a second place finish in the 200 free (1:49.65), took third in the 800 free relay (7:24.50), and finished fifth in the 200 free relay (1:34.68), the 400 medley relay (3:45.91), the 100 free (51.15) and the 400 free relay (3:26.14) at the Horizon League Championships (Feb. 22-25).

AS A FRESHMAN (2015-16): Placed second in the 200 free (1:52.42), 100 free (52.45) and 200 IM (2:08.43) in a triple dual meet against University of Chicago, Northwestern and Denison (Oct. 24) … finished second in the 50 free (24.40) and 200 free relay (1:38.13) versus Milwaukee (Nov. 7) … captured third in the 200 IM (2:10.20) and 200 free (1:54.57) as well as fourth place in the 100 free (52.77) at a double dual meet against Oakland and Wright State (Nov. 14) … claimed second place in the 200 free (2:03.59) and 200 IM (1:50.00) at the TYR Invitational (Nov. 20-22) … grabbed the top spot in the 200 free (1:52.75), 100 free (52.05) and 50 free (24.37) at Green Bay (Dec. 12) … notched first place in the 200 free (1:53.55), 100 free (51.96) and 400 free relay (3:36.08) at Cleveland State (Jan. 15) … placed second while setting the UIC record in the 200 IM (2:02.52) and collected a sixth place finish in the 200 free (1:50.48) at the Horizon League Championships (Feb. 24-27).

PREP/PERSONAL: Member of three-time conference and sectional championship team...swam the 100 fly and 200 free, setting school records in both events...won conference and sectionals all four years in both events...qualified for state all four years and was a two time All-State selection...three time conference MVP...daughter of Russel and Kelly Joy...majoring in psychology.
